http://www.nydailynews.com/front/sto...p-411551c.html _____________ 'TRL' looks to be D.O.A. Is time up for “TRL”? An insider says MTV could soon bring the ax down on its signature countdown show because nobody watches it. “The ratings are at an all-time low, around 300,000 viewers,” says the source. “The show is going to be canceled and rebranded." (In other words, MTV has created a generation of viewers who don’t have the attention span to watch a music video.) Recent data from Nielsen media peg TRL’s viewership at 393,000, down from almost 600,000 in 2001. The rotating cast of veejays who present the live show, which launched in 1998, includes Nick Lachey’s galpal Vanessa Minnillo, Damien Fahey and Susie Castillo. Last Thursday, under-performing MTV president Michael Wolf abruptly left his job, although he said the decision to do so was his. |
